National Society of Real Estate Appraisers

The National Society of Real Estate Appraisers (NSREA) is dedicated to promoting the highest standards of professionalism among its members. Founded to advance the science and art of real property valuation, NSREA provides equal opportunity to all men and women who are committed to excellence in the appraisal profession.

Through rigorous examination, the awarding of the prestigious CREA (Certified Real Estate Appraiser) designation, and a strong commitment to continuing education, NSREA members lead the industry in ethical conduct and professional competency.

As a 501(c)(3) nonprofit, NSREA is dedicated to expanding awareness of appraisal and valuation careers among students and underserved communities. Career Pathways to Success 2026 introduces participants to careers in residential and commercial real estate appraisal, business valuation, fine art and antiques, personal property, and equipment valuation — and welcomes members of the military community transitioning out of active service into the valuation industry.

Savannah State University

America's oldest public HBCU — a historic and inspiring setting for the NSREA Annual Conference.

🏛️

Historic HBCU Campus

Founded in 1890, Savannah State is Georgia's oldest public HBCU and a landmark of African American educational excellence.
